Members with a Shared Vision

Ensuring Vermonters' Rights are Protected

45 Years ago: The Association was formed to promote greater proficiency and effectiveness among its members in all phases and types of litigation, and to sponsor, support or oppose legislation to best serve the administration of justice and the cause of advocacy.

Today: The Vermont Association for Justice (VTAJ) works to promote a fair and effective civil justice system and protects the rights of those injured by the misconduct or negligence of others. We support the continuing education, professionalism, and legal practices of our attorney, paralegal, and other members. 
 


Executive Director (open position) 

Vermont Association for Justice

About Us

The Vermont Association for Justice (VTAJ) is the voice of Vermont's plaintiff lawyers. VTAJ is the group of attorneys who stand up for injured Vermonters and ensure access to justice. We are a passionate, member-driven organization committed to strengthening the civil justice system, advocating at the State House, and supporting the legal community across Vermont.

After years of dedicated leadership from our Executive Director, VTAJ is searching for a mission-driven leader to carry this work forward.

The Opportunity

This is a rare and rewarding opportunity to lead a close-knit statewide association at the intersection of law, advocacy, and community service. Tasks include building relationships with VTAJ members, working alongside lobbyists during the legislative session, and keeping the organization running with energy and purpose.

The Executive Director will work directly with the Board of Governors and the Executive Board, manage a meaningful portfolio of programs and events, and serve as a point of contact for an organization that genuinely makes a difference in Vermonter’s lives.

What You’ll Do

  • Handle day-to-day operations of VTAJ and support the Board in setting strategic direction.
  • Help coordinate the work of lobbyists during legislative sessions.
  • Help plan and execute legal education programs, seminars, and member events throughout the year.
  • Manage member communications, the VTAJ newsletter, website, and social presence.
  • Maintain relationships with national partners including AAJ and NATLE.
  • Oversee the Association's membership dues, budget, and finances in partnership with the Finance Committee.

What We’re Looking For

  • A leader who is energized by mission-driven work and genuinely cares about access to justice.
  • Experience in association management, nonprofit leadership, law, or advocacy projects
  • A strong communicator who is comfortable representing the organization.
  • An organized, self-directed individual who is capable of managing multiple priorities.
  • Familiarity with Vermont's legal or legislative landscape is a plus, but not required.

VTAJ - Rule of Law 
  The Vermont Association for Justice (VTAJ) joins the American Association for Justice (AAJ), the American Bar Association (ABA), the Vermont Bar Association (VBA), and other legal organizations nationwide in vigorously supporting and respecting the rule of law. 
  VTAJ works to safeguard rights, promote fairness, and strengthen access to civil justice. We are committed to a fair and impartial legal system that protects the rights and safety of all people. 
  VTAJ supports diverse opinions and perspectives, but above all, we all support the rule of law and the legal system, which is the bedrock of our system of government. As lawyers, we swore an oath to protect the law. 
  Courts play an integral role in upholding the rule of law, and the independence and safety of judges is paramount to an effective legal system.  Lawyers are also essential to maintaining the rule of law and should not be punished or threatened for advancing their clients’ interests in court.  
  VTAJ calls upon all branches of our government to adhere to the rule of law and our Constitution and respect the legal processes and procedures of our judicial system.
